FLEET MANAGEMENT SYSTEM
First Claim
Patent Images
1. A method of implementing inspection checklists for materials handling vehicles comprising:
- requiring an operator to complete a checklist having a plurality of checklist items before deciding whether to enable the materials handling vehicle for normal operation, the checklist completed by performing for each of the plurality of checklist items at least;
presenting a next item in the checklist to the operator;
receiving a response to the presented item from the operator; and
recording the response from the operator;
performing an operator response verification for at least one of the plurality of checklist items by querying at least one component of the materials handling vehicle to determine whether the operator complied with a corresponding checklist item;
taking a predetermined action if the query results indicate that the operator did not complete the corresponding checklist item properly;
wirelessly conveying the checklist responses to computer for storage;
evaluating the results of the checklist; and
enabling the materials handling vehicle for normal operation if the results of completing the checklist indicate that the materials handling vehicle is suitable for operation.

Abstract
Systems of hardware and software are provided for enabling mobile assets to communicate across a wireless network environment. Systems, computer-implemented methods and computer program products are also provided for leveraging wireless communication and/or processing capabilities of mobile assets against a robust software solution to implement enterprise wide asset management functions, to integrate mobile asset data into existing enterprise workflows and/or to enable trusted third party integration into the enterprise for enhanced asset and/or workflow management.

12. A method of wirelessly interacting with a materials handling vehicle to implement position dependent operation comprising:
-
providing a transceiver on a materials handling vehicle, the transceiver configured for wireless data communication across a wireless computing environment; configuring a processor on the materials handling vehicle to communicate with the transceiver for wireless communication across the wireless computing environment to a corresponding server computer; providing a device on the materials handling vehicle that is utilized to determine a position of the materials handling vehicle; configuring the processor to communicate with the device to obtain information relating to the position of the materials handling vehicle; configuring the processor to implement at least one function on the materials handling vehicle by wirelessly communicating the obtained position related information between the server computer and the materials handling vehicle via the transceiver such that the position of the materials handling vehicle is determined; and interacting with at least one component of the materials handling vehicle to perform a predetermined action in response to receiving a command from the server computer based upon the determined position of the materials handling vehicle.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15, 16, 17)
